Ducommun(DCO)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-05-06 17: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Q1 2025 revenue was $194.1 million, a 1.7% increase from $190.8 million in Q1 2024, marking the sixteenth consecutive quarter of year-over-year revenue growth [9][25] - Gross margin increased to 26.6%, up 200 basis points from 24.6% year-over-year, achieving a new quarterly record [13][26] - Adjusted EBITDA reached 15.9%, a record as a percentage of sales, up from 14.4% in the prior year [14][31] - GAAP diluted EPS was $0.69, compared to $0.46 in Q1 2024, while adjusted diluted EPS was $0.83, up from $0.70 [14][31]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Military and space revenue grew by 15% year-over-year to $114 million, driven by missile and electronic warfare programs [10][21] - Commercial aerospace revenue declined by 10% to $72 million, marking the first decline in 15 quarters, primarily due to lower demand for the 737 MAX [11][22] - Industrial business revenue decreased to $9 million as the company continues to prune non-core operations [23]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The defense backlog increased by over $15 million year-over-year to $620 million, representing 59% of the total backlog [15][21] - The commercial aerospace backlog decreased by $31 million to $411 million due to lower OEM production rates [16][22] - The company expects a recovery in commercial aerospace as production rates ramp up in 2025 [22]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is executing its Vision 2027 strategy, aiming to increase the revenue percentage from engineered products, which accounted for 23% in 2024, up from 19% in 2023 [9][17] - The strategy includes targeted acquisitions, consolidation of manufacturing operations, and expansion in high-growth segments of the defense budget [9][10] - The company is focused on maintaining a strong mix of defense and commercial aerospace to mitigate risks associated with market cyclicality [10][70]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ed optimism about the recovery in commercial aerospace and continued strength in defense, reaffirming guidance for mid-single-digit revenue growth for 2025 [18][70] - The company does not anticipate significant impacts from tariffs on its revenues, as 95% of its revenue is generated in the U.S. [19][29] - Management highlighted the importance of maintaining operational efficiency and strong relationships with key customers like Boeing and Spirit [83][84] Other Important Information - The company has ceased operations in two facilities, expecting to realize cost savings as production ramps up in other locations [13][36] - Cash flow from operating activities improved to $800,000 in Q1 2025, compared to a use of $1.6 million in Q1 2024 [38] - The company is actively pursuing M&A opportunities, focusing on niche engineered product businesses that span both defense and commercial aerospace [54][56] Q&A Session Summary Question: How would you characterize any delay in ship set rates to Boeing and Spirit? - Management noted that Boeing is producing in the low twenties and Spirit is ramping up to the mid to high twenties, with expectations for continued growth despite destocking impacts [43][45] Question: Are you tracking towards your M&A placeholder for Vision 2027? - Management confirmed they are tracking multiple opportunities and remain confident in completing a deal this year [54][56] Question: What are your expectations for growth rates between commercial aerospace and defense for the remainder of the year? - Management expects continued strength in defense and a recovery in commercial aerospace, aiming for mid-single-digit growth overall [68][70]
JCDecaux : Q1 2025 trading update
Globenewswire· 2025-05-06 15:41
Core Insights - The company reported a record revenue of €858 million for Q1 2025, reflecting a 7.0% increase compared to Q1 2024, with organic revenue growth at 5.5% [2][8] - Digital revenue growth was particularly strong at 17.0%, with programmatic digital out-of-home (OOH) media revenue increasing by 29.9% [3][4] - The company anticipates low single-digit organic revenue growth for Q2 2025 due to global economic uncertainties and the impact of major events like the Paris Olympic Games and UEFA Euro 2024 [5][16] Revenue Breakdown - Total revenue for Q1 2025 was €858 million, up from €801.6 million in Q1 2024, with organic growth of 5.5% after excluding foreign exchange impacts [8][10] - Revenue by segment: - Street Furniture: €422.5 million, +5.4% reported growth, +5.3% organic growth [10][12] - Transport: €315 million, +9.3% reported growth, +6.1% organic growth [10][13] - Billboard: €120.5 million, +7.1% reported growth, +4.6% organic growth [10][14] Geographic Performance - All geographic regions experienced growth in Q1 2025, with notable contributions from Rest of Europe, North America, and the Rest of the World [4][9] - The Asia-Pacific region showed low single-digit growth, primarily due to flat performance in China [13] Future Outlook - For Q2 2025, the company expects organic revenue growth to be low single-digit, with Street Furniture pacing mid-single digit while Transport and Billboard are currently flat [5][16] - The company will hold its Annual General Meeting of Shareholders on May 14, 2025, and will report half-year results on July 31, 2025 [16]

JNJ vs. ABBV: Which Pharma Powerhouse Has Better Growth Prospects?
ZACKS· 2025-05-06 13:30
Core Viewpoint - Johnson & Johnson (JNJ) and AbbVie (ABBV) are both major U.S. pharmaceutical companies with strong pipelines and global operations, but they face different challenges and growth prospects as they approach 2025, which is expected to be a catalyst year for both companies [2]. Group 1: Johnson & Johnson (JNJ) - JNJ's diversified business model, operating through over 275 subsidiaries, provides resilience against economic cycles [3]. - The Innovative Medicine unit showed a 4.4% organic sales growth in Q1 2025 despite the loss of exclusivity for Stelara, with growth expected to be driven by key products and new drug launches [4][5]. - JNJ's MedTech business is experiencing challenges, particularly in China, due to the volume-based procurement program and competitive pressures [6]. - The loss of U.S. patent exclusivity for Stelara in 2025 led to a 33.7% decline in its sales in Q1 2025, with generics expected to further impact sales and profits [7]. - JNJ is facing over 62,000 lawsuits related to its talc-based products, which has created a negative sentiment around the stock [8][9]. - JNJ's 2025 sales and EPS estimates indicate a year-over-year increase of 2.7% and 6.2%, respectively, with the EPS estimate slightly rising over the past month [14]. - JNJ's stock has risen 8.1% year-to-date, outperforming the industry average of 2.4% [21]. - JNJ's current price/earnings ratio is 14.44, slightly below the industry average of 15.70, and its dividend yield is 3.2% [23][24]. - JNJ expects operational sales growth to accelerate in the second half of 2025, driven by new product launches [29]. Group 2: AbbVie (ABBV) - AbbVie has successfully managed the loss of exclusivity for Humira, launching new immunology drugs Skyrizi and Rinvoq, which are expected to generate over $31 billion in combined sales by 2027 [10]. - The oncology strategy is gaining traction with contributions from newer products, and AbbVie has several early/mid-stage pipeline candidates with blockbuster potential [11]. - AbbVie has been active in acquisitions, strengthening its pipeline in immunology and entering the obesity market through a licensing deal [12]. - AbbVie faces near-term challenges, including biosimilar erosion of Humira and competitive pressures on its cancer drug Imbruvica [13]. - AbbVie's 2025 sales and EPS estimates imply a year-over-year increase of 6.4% and 21.2%, respectively, with the EPS estimate slightly declining over the past month [17]. - AbbVie's stock has risen 12.4% year-to-date, also outperforming the industry average [21]. - AbbVie's current price/earnings ratio is 15.22, lower than the industry average but higher than its 5-year mean of 12.23, with a dividend yield of around 3.4% [23][24]. - AbbVie expects to achieve mid-single-digit revenue growth in 2025 and a high single-digit CAGR through 2029, with no significant loss of exclusivity events anticipated for the rest of the decade [31].

Genie Energy(GNE)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-05-06 12:30
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Consolidated revenue increased by 14.3% or $17.1 million to $136.8 million, driven by strong performance in Genie Retail Energy [10] - Consolidated gross profit rose by 10.6% to $37.4 million, while gross margin decreased by 90 basis points to 27.3% [11][12] - Consolidated net income attributable to stockholders increased by $10.6 million or $0.40 per share from $8.1 million or $0.30 per share a year earlier [13]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Genie Retail Energy (GRE) revenue jumped 17.8% to $132.5 million, primarily due to investments made to grow the customer base [10] - Electricity revenue climbed 16.4% to $104.1 million, contributing 78.6% of GRE's revenues, with kilowatt hours sold increasing by 23.5% [10] - Revenue from natural gas sales increased by 26.8% to $28.4 million, reflecting increases in both terms sold and revenues per term sold [11]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Customer churn in the first quarter was 5.5%, unchanged from the year-ago quarter, indicating effective customer retention efforts [5] - The company ended the quarter with approximately 413,000 meters served, comprising 402,000 Residential Customer Equivalents (RCEs) [4]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is expanding its customer base and has begun marketing in California, with plans to offer gas in Kentucky in the second quarter [5] - The community solar project in Lansing, New York, is on track for completion in the third quarter and is expected to be EBITDA accretive immediately upon going online [6]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management highlighted strong operational and financial results, indicating a return to normalized results for the retail energy business [3] - The company confirmed its full-year adjusted EBITDA guidance of $40 million to $50 million, suggesting confidence in future performance [14] Other Important Information - The company returned $3.9 million to stockholders through dividends and share repurchases during the first quarter [7] - Cash, cash equivalents, and marketable securities totaled $210.2 million as of March 31, 2025, an increase of $9.2 million in the quarter [13] Q&A Session Summary - There were no questions during the Q&A session, leading to the conclusion of the conference call [16]
Bioventus Reports First Quarter Financial Results
Globenewswire· 2025-05-06 11:30
Core Viewpoint - Bioventus Inc. reported a decline in revenue for the first quarter of 2025, primarily due to the divestiture of its Advanced Rehabilitation Business, but achieved organic revenue growth across all business segments, indicating resilience in its strategic execution despite macroeconomic challenges [2][6]. Financial Performance - Worldwide revenue for Q1 2025 was $123.9 million, a decrease of 4.3% from $129.5 million in the same period last year, largely impacted by the divestiture [2][5]. - Organic revenue increased by 5.0%, reflecting positive growth across all three business segments [2][6]. - The net loss attributable to Bioventus Inc. was $2.6 million, an improvement from a net loss of $4.9 million in the prior-year period [3][4]. - Adjusted EBITDA for the quarter was $19.2 million, down from $22.6 million in the previous year, primarily due to the divestiture and planned growth investments [3][6]. Revenue Breakdown by Business - U.S. revenue from Pain Treatments was $52.7 million, up 4.0% year-over-year, while Surgical Solutions revenue increased by 6.5% to $40.8 million [5][8]. - Restorative Therapies revenue fell by 32.9% to $17.0 million, significantly affected by the divestiture of the Advanced Rehabilitation Business [5][9]. - International revenue totaled $13.4 million, a decline of 12.0%, with Pain Treatments and Surgical Solutions showing modest growth, while Restorative Therapies revenue dropped by 47.1% [5][9]. Strategic Developments - The company reiterated its financial guidance for 2025, expecting net sales between $560 million and $570 million, reflecting organic growth of approximately 6.1% to 8.0% when accounting for the divestiture [10][13]. - Adjusted EBITDA guidance for 2025 is set between $112 million and $116 million, indicating a potential increase in Adjusted EBITDA margin compared to 2024 [10][13]. - Non-GAAP EPS is projected to be between $0.64 and $0.68, representing a growth of 30.6% to 38.8% [10][13].
Three-month interim report (Q1) 2025 (unaudited)
Globenewswire· 2025-05-06 05:30
Core Viewpoint - ALK reported strong Q1 results with a 12% organic revenue growth and a 50% increase in operating profit, driven by robust sales across all regions and product lines [1][7][9] Financial Performance - Total revenue for Q1 2025 reached DKK 1,522 million, up from DKK 1,351 million, reflecting a 12% growth in local currencies and a 13% increase in reported terms [3][7] - Operating profit (EBIT) surged by 50% to DKK 469 million, compared to DKK 316 million in Q1 2024, with an EBIT margin of 31%, up from 23% [3][7] - Free cash flow nearly tripled to DKK 330 million, driven by increased earnings, while CAPEX remained stable at DKK 57 million [7] Sales Growth - Global tablet sales increased by 22% to DKK 857 million, with European tablet sales growing by 17% due to an influx of new patients [7][8] - Revenue growth in Europe and International markets was 10% and 24% respectively, while North America saw a 14% rebound [7] Strategic Developments - The launch of the house dust mite tablet for children positively impacted sales, with initial market responses exceeding expectations [8] - ALK is progressing well with the market access for the neffy adrenaline nasal spray, expecting first launches in Europe by Q3 2025 [8] - The company has entered a four-year agreement with ARS Pharma to co-promote the neffy adrenaline nasal spray in the USA [8] Outlook - The full-year revenue growth outlook remains unchanged at 9-13%, primarily driven by higher volumes in allergy immunotherapy and anaphylaxis products [6][9] - The EBIT margin is anticipated to improve by 5 percentage points to around 25%, supported by revenue growth and optimization efforts [9]
一季度我国规上互联网企业完成互联网业务收入同比增长1.4%
news flash· 2025-05-06 03:06
一季度我国规模以上互联网企业完成互联网业务收入4118亿元,同比增长1.4%。研发经费增速加快, 一季度规模以上互联网企业共投入研发经费204.5亿元,同比增长4.6%,增速较1—2月份提高1.8个百分 点。东部地区互联网业务收入稳步增长,一季度东部地区完成互联网业务收入3676亿元,同比增长 2.9%,高于全国增速1.5个百分点,占全国互联网业务收入的89.3%。京津冀地区互联网业务收入较快增 长,一季度京津冀地区完成互联网业务收入1251亿元,同比增长7.1%,占全国互联网业务收入的 30.4%。(工信微报) ...
